Brendon Carolan appointed Mens 1st’s Coach, Director of Coaching
The Executive Committee are delighted to announce the appointment of Brendon Carolan as the Men’s first team coach and Director of Coaching for the coming season.
Brendon is a High Performance FIH Qualified coach, and was awarded South African Coach of the year for 2009. Brendon is currently the Men’s Head Coach of the Province of KwaZulu Natal in Durban, South Africa, who were the State winners in 2009, and is Director of Hockey at Glenwood High School in Durban. He has also been Head Coach for South Africa U17, U18 and U19A Teams from 2008 to date.
Brendon Carolan
Brendon brings a wealth of coaching experience with him and he has the calibre to take on the men’s first side as they head into another busy and challenging season, of defending the Leinster Senior League, the Leinster Senior Cup, the Irish Indoor Cup and the Irish Hockey League, and also preparing for the first round of the EHL in the Autumn.
We are delighted that Brendon will be also be taking on the role as Director of Coaching for the club. In our discussions with him, he is very passionate about this role as he has had a lot of experience in this area. We are confident that all of the club, mens and ladies sections and of course the Colts/Fillies section, will all benefit from his wealth of experience.
